Beginnings of the Auguste characterThere is an extensively told legend regarding the origins of the Auguste clown. According to the tale, an American acrobat called Tom Belling was doing with a circus in Germany in 1869


The supervisor all of a sudden went into the area. Belling removed running, ending up in the circus field where he tipped over the ringcurb. In his humiliation and haste to run away, he tipped over the ringcurb once again on his escape. The target market shouted, "auguste!" which is German for fool. The manager commanded that Belling continue looking like the Auguste.

Early auguste clowns had a naturalistic appearance as if they had just wandered off the road into the circus ring. The overstated make up associated with the auguste clown today was presented by Albert Fratellini, of the Fratellini Brothers.

No person understands where the mummers' plays and Morris dancings originated from. In such plays there is a combination of personalities consisting of "kings" and "saints", cross-dressing, and blackface roles; the faces of Morris (or "Moorish") dancers were additionally smudged. The mummer's plays were not for fun. Most were carried out by paupers in the starving time after Xmas.


If denied, they would certainly plow the transgressor's backyard. The Derby Play of the Tup was executed for food and beer by out of work youths. This use of blackface for political activity camouflaged as entertainment continued America when the descendants of these males blackened their faces to protest tax obligations. One such protest has gotten in American background as the Boston Tea Celebration.

While not the extravagant events we assume of today, some early, rougher kinds of taking a trip circus were preferred in America from Revolutionary times-- George Washington was a follower. Blackface clowns done in them from at the very least the 1810s and maybe before; they were a staple by the 1820s. The large red or white mouth painted on by contemporary clowns is a remnant of the blackface mask.




In many areas minstrelsy was birthed when article these entertainers moved their acts from the tent to the phase of American selection movie theaters. Certainly there was a strong aspect of clowning in minstrelsy. The blackface mask was a clown's camouflage, overemphasizing the facial functions into an animation, a caricature. The blackface clown might be the precursor of today's anodyne circus clown, yet otherwise both are as contrary as blackface and whiteface.
